Using Your iPAQ Pocket PC with HP ProtectTools Unlocking Your Pocket PC The authentication method for unlocking your Pocket PC is as follows: ■ Swipe your fingerprint and/or enter your PIN and/or password when prompted. If you successfully enter the requested information, the device unlocks. ■ After the number of attempts you selected during setup, if you still do not successfully swipe your fingerprint and/or enter your PIN and/or password correctly, you are prompted to answer the hint question you defined. If you successfully answer your hint question, the device unlocks. Note: After you successfully authenticate, you are prompted to reset any authentication information you didn't enter correctly.
